Judge Denies Motion To Reconsider Decision In Miss N.C. Case

Posted Updated

RALEIGH, N.C. — Judge Narley Cashwell denied a motion Monday to reconsider his prior ruling in the Miss North Carolina case.

Cashwell originally ruled that the Miss North Carolina organization should not recognize Rebekah Revels and Misty Clymer as Miss North Carolina until the case goes to arbitration. Barry Nakell, Revels' attorney, filed the motion asking the judge to reconsider his ruling.

Cashwell also ruled that the Miss America officials should not be a part of the lawsuit. On Monday, Nakell asked to have Miss America brought back into the lawsuit. Attorneys for the state pageant and the Miss America organization argued that they agreed with the judge's decision and his ruling should not be reconsidered.

He said this type of motion should have been taken before the Court of Appeals and not him.
